RE: [flexcoders] Passing variables into an alert handler

2005-08-03 Thread Jeff Beeman
Hmm... looks interesting.  I'll give it a shot, thanks!


/**
* Jeff Beeman
**/


-Original Message-
From: flexcoders@yahoogroups.com [mailto:[EMAIL PROTECTED] On Behalf Of Matt 
Chotin
Sent: Tuesday, August 02, 2005 7:37 PM
To: flexcoders@yahoogroups.com
Subject: RE: [flexcoders] Passing variables into an alert handler

You could essentially use an anonymous function in there.  Something like this:

Alert(..., Delegate.create(this, function(event) { this.alertHandler({myVar: 
'apples'}); });

Matt

-Original Message-
From: flexcoders@yahoogroups.com [mailto:[EMAIL PROTECTED] On Behalf Of Ashish 
Goyal
Sent: Tuesday, August 02, 2005 2:37 PM
To: flexcoders@yahoogroups.com
Subject: RE: [flexcoders] Passing variables into an alert handler


I just reread your question and it seems like you already got that part which I 
have mentioned in my previous post. About the passing of events, I tried adding 
event as the 3rd parameter and getting the event.target value but it returns 
blank. 
Somebody on the flexcodes who have played around with events should be able to 
answer your question..


> -Original Message-
> From: flexcoders@yahoogroups.com 
> [mailto:[EMAIL PROTECTED] On Behalf Of Ashish Goyal
> Sent: Tuesday, August 02, 2005 2:23 PM
> To: flexcoders@yahoogroups.com
> Subject: RE: [flexcoders] Passing variables into an alert handler
> 
> 
> How about simple passing the parameters like:
> 
>  Alert(... ..., Delegate.create(this, 
> this.alertHandler('apples','Bar'));
> 
> And in your alertHandler(myVar,myFoo), you can get the values 
> of your parameters.
> 
> Does this answer your question?
> 
> Thanks
> -Ashish
> 
> 
> 
> > -Original Message-
> > From: flexcoders@yahoogroups.com 
> > [mailto:[EMAIL PROTECTED] On Behalf Of Jeff Beeman
> > Sent: Tuesday, August 02, 2005 9:17 AM
> > To: flexcoders@yahoogroups.com
> > Subject: [flexcoders] Passing variables into an alert handler
> > 
> > I'm trying to pass variables into the Delegate that I have 
> > run during an
> > alert.  Here is the code I currently have:
> > 
> > alert("Delete record?", "Alert", mx.controls.Alert.OK |
> > mx.controls.Alert.CANCEL, Delegate.create(this, this.alertHandler),
> > mx.controls.Alert.CANCEL);
> > 
> > I would like to be able to pass variables into the 
> alertHandler, i.e.:
> > 
> > Alert(... ..., Delegate.create(this, this.alertHandler({ 
> > myVar:'apples',
> > myFoo:'Bar' });
> > 
> > This works... but the problem is that the 'event' is no 
> longer passed.
> > Trying to add 'myEvent:event' to that object doesn't work, 
> as I get an
> > error returned saying 'event' doesn't exist.
> > 
> > Is there a way to pass variables using the method above while still
> > capturing the event details?
> > 
> > 
> > 
> > 
> > /***
> > * Jeff Beeman
> > * Digital Media & Instructional Technologies
> > * Arizona State University
> > ***/
> > 
> > 
> > 
> > 
> > 
> >  Yahoo! Groups Sponsor 
> > ~--> 
> >  > href="http://us.ard.yahoo.com/SIG=12hn4jb9f/M=362131.6882499.7
> > 825260.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123006875
> > /A=2889191/R=0/SIG=10r90krvo/*http://www.thebeehive.org
> > ">Get Bzzzy! (real tools to help you find a job) Welcome to 
> > the Sweet Life - brought to you by One Economy.
> > --
> > --~-> 
> > 
> > --
> > Flexcoders Mailing List
> > FAQ: 
> http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> > Search Archives: 
> > http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> > Yahoo! Groups Links
> > 
> > 
> > 
> >  
> > 
> > 
> > 
> 
> 
>  Yahoo! Groups Sponsor 
> ~--> 
>  href="http://us.ard.yahoo.com/SIG=12htq29fs/M=362329.6886308.7
> 839368.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123024998
> /A=2894321/R=0/SIG=11dvsfulr/*http://youthnoise.com/page.php?p
> age_id=1992
> ">Fair play? Video games influencing politics. Click and talk 
> back!.
> --
> --~-> 
> 
> --
> Flexcoders Mailing List
> FAQ: http://groups.yah

RE: [flexcoders] Passing variables into an alert handler

2005-08-02 Thread Matt Chotin
You could essentially use an anonymous function in there.  Something like this:

Alert(..., Delegate.create(this, function(event) { this.alertHandler({myVar: 
'apples'}); });

Matt

-Original Message-
From: flexcoders@yahoogroups.com [mailto:[EMAIL PROTECTED] On Behalf Of Ashish 
Goyal
Sent: Tuesday, August 02, 2005 2:37 PM
To: flexcoders@yahoogroups.com
Subject: RE: [flexcoders] Passing variables into an alert handler


I just reread your question and it seems like you already got that part which I 
have mentioned in my previous post. About the passing of events, I tried adding 
event as the 3rd parameter and getting the event.target value but it returns 
blank. 
Somebody on the flexcodes who have played around with events should be able to 
answer your question..


> -Original Message-
> From: flexcoders@yahoogroups.com 
> [mailto:[EMAIL PROTECTED] On Behalf Of Ashish Goyal
> Sent: Tuesday, August 02, 2005 2:23 PM
> To: flexcoders@yahoogroups.com
> Subject: RE: [flexcoders] Passing variables into an alert handler
> 
> 
> How about simple passing the parameters like:
> 
>  Alert(... ..., Delegate.create(this, 
> this.alertHandler('apples','Bar'));
> 
> And in your alertHandler(myVar,myFoo), you can get the values 
> of your parameters.
> 
> Does this answer your question?
> 
> Thanks
> -Ashish
> 
> 
> 
> > -Original Message-
> > From: flexcoders@yahoogroups.com 
> > [mailto:[EMAIL PROTECTED] On Behalf Of Jeff Beeman
> > Sent: Tuesday, August 02, 2005 9:17 AM
> > To: flexcoders@yahoogroups.com
> > Subject: [flexcoders] Passing variables into an alert handler
> > 
> > I'm trying to pass variables into the Delegate that I have 
> > run during an
> > alert.  Here is the code I currently have:
> > 
> > alert("Delete record?", "Alert", mx.controls.Alert.OK |
> > mx.controls.Alert.CANCEL, Delegate.create(this, this.alertHandler),
> > mx.controls.Alert.CANCEL);
> > 
> > I would like to be able to pass variables into the 
> alertHandler, i.e.:
> > 
> > Alert(... ..., Delegate.create(this, this.alertHandler({ 
> > myVar:'apples',
> > myFoo:'Bar' });
> > 
> > This works... but the problem is that the 'event' is no 
> longer passed.
> > Trying to add 'myEvent:event' to that object doesn't work, 
> as I get an
> > error returned saying 'event' doesn't exist.
> > 
> > Is there a way to pass variables using the method above while still
> > capturing the event details?
> > 
> > 
> > 
> > 
> > /***
> > * Jeff Beeman
> > * Digital Media & Instructional Technologies
> > * Arizona State University
> > ***/
> > 
> > 
> > 
> > 
> > 
> >  Yahoo! Groups Sponsor 
> > ~--> 
> >  > href="http://us.ard.yahoo.com/SIG=12hn4jb9f/M=362131.6882499.7
> > 825260.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123006875
> > /A=2889191/R=0/SIG=10r90krvo/*http://www.thebeehive.org
> > ">Get Bzzzy! (real tools to help you find a job) Welcome to 
> > the Sweet Life - brought to you by One Economy.
> > --
> > --~-> 
> > 
> > --
> > Flexcoders Mailing List
> > FAQ: 
> http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> > Search Archives: 
> > http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> > Yahoo! Groups Links
> > 
> > 
> > 
> >  
> > 
> > 
> > 
> 
> 
>  Yahoo! Groups Sponsor 
> ~--> 
>  href="http://us.ard.yahoo.com/SIG=12htq29fs/M=362329.6886308.7
> 839368.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123024998
> /A=2894321/R=0/SIG=11dvsfulr/*http://youthnoise.com/page.php?p
> age_id=1992
> ">Fair play? Video games influencing politics. Click and talk 
> back!.
> --
> --~-> 
> 
> --
> Flexcoders Mailing List
> F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> Search Archives: 
> http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> Yahoo! Groups Links
> 
> 
> 
>  
> 
> 
> 



--
Flexcoders Mailing List
F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com 
Yahoo! Groups Links



 




--

RE: [flexcoders] Passing variables into an alert handler

2005-08-02 Thread Ashish Goyal

I just reread your question and it seems like you already got that part which I 
have mentioned in my previous post. About the passing of events, I tried adding 
event as the 3rd parameter and getting the event.target value but it returns 
blank. 
Somebody on the flexcodes who have played around with events should be able to 
answer your question..


> -Original Message-
> From: flexcoders@yahoogroups.com 
> [mailto:[EMAIL PROTECTED] On Behalf Of Ashish Goyal
> Sent: Tuesday, August 02, 2005 2:23 PM
> To: flexcoders@yahoogroups.com
> Subject: RE: [flexcoders] Passing variables into an alert handler
> 
> 
> How about simple passing the parameters like:
> 
>  Alert(... ..., Delegate.create(this, 
> this.alertHandler('apples','Bar'));
> 
> And in your alertHandler(myVar,myFoo), you can get the values 
> of your parameters.
> 
> Does this answer your question?
> 
> Thanks
> -Ashish
> 
> 
> 
> > -Original Message-
> > From: flexcoders@yahoogroups.com 
> > [mailto:[EMAIL PROTECTED] On Behalf Of Jeff Beeman
> > Sent: Tuesday, August 02, 2005 9:17 AM
> > To: flexcoders@yahoogroups.com
> > Subject: [flexcoders] Passing variables into an alert handler
> > 
> > I'm trying to pass variables into the Delegate that I have 
> > run during an
> > alert.  Here is the code I currently have:
> > 
> > alert("Delete record?", "Alert", mx.controls.Alert.OK |
> > mx.controls.Alert.CANCEL, Delegate.create(this, this.alertHandler),
> > mx.controls.Alert.CANCEL);
> > 
> > I would like to be able to pass variables into the 
> alertHandler, i.e.:
> > 
> > Alert(... ..., Delegate.create(this, this.alertHandler({ 
> > myVar:'apples',
> > myFoo:'Bar' });
> > 
> > This works... but the problem is that the 'event' is no 
> longer passed.
> > Trying to add 'myEvent:event' to that object doesn't work, 
> as I get an
> > error returned saying 'event' doesn't exist.
> > 
> > Is there a way to pass variables using the method above while still
> > capturing the event details?
> > 
> > 
> > 
> > 
> > /***
> > * Jeff Beeman
> > * Digital Media & Instructional Technologies
> > * Arizona State University
> > ***/
> > 
> > 
> > 
> > 
> > 
> >  Yahoo! Groups Sponsor 
> > ~--> 
> >  > href="http://us.ard.yahoo.com/SIG=12hn4jb9f/M=362131.6882499.7
> > 825260.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123006875
> > /A=2889191/R=0/SIG=10r90krvo/*http://www.thebeehive.org
> > ">Get Bzzzy! (real tools to help you find a job) Welcome to 
> > the Sweet Life - brought to you by One Economy.
> > --
> > --~-> 
> > 
> > --
> > Flexcoders Mailing List
> > FAQ: 
> http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> > Search Archives: 
> > http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> > Yahoo! Groups Links
> > 
> > 
> > 
> >  
> > 
> > 
> > 
> 
> 
>  Yahoo! Groups Sponsor 
> ~--> 
>  href="http://us.ard.yahoo.com/SIG=12htq29fs/M=362329.6886308.7
> 839368.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123024998
> /A=2894321/R=0/SIG=11dvsfulr/*http://youthnoise.com/page.php?p
> age_id=1992
> ">Fair play? Video games influencing politics. Click and talk 
> back!.
> --
> --~-> 
> 
> --
> Flexcoders Mailing List
> F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> Search Archives: 
> http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> Yahoo! Groups Links
> 
> 
> 
>  
> 
> 
> 


 Yahoo! Groups Sponsor ~--> 
http://us.ard.yahoo.com/SIG=12hsc3iup/M=362131.6882499.7825260.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123025860/A=2889191/R=0/SIG=10r90krvo/*http://www.thebeehive.org
">Get Bzzzy! (real tools to help you find a job) Welcome to the Sweet Life 
- brought to you by One Economy.
~-> 

--
Flexcoders Mailing List
F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com 
Yahoo! Groups Links

<*> To visit your group on the web, go to:
http://groups.yahoo.com/group/flexcoders/

<*> To unsubscribe from this group, send an email to:
[EMAIL PROTECTED]

<*> Your use of Yahoo! Groups is subject to:
http://docs.yahoo.com/info/terms/
 




RE: [flexcoders] Passing variables into an alert handler

2005-08-02 Thread Ashish Goyal

How about simple passing the parameters like:

 Alert(... ..., Delegate.create(this, this.alertHandler('apples','Bar'));

And in your alertHandler(myVar,myFoo), you can get the values of your 
parameters.

Does this answer your question?

Thanks
-Ashish



> -Original Message-
> From: flexcoders@yahoogroups.com 
> [mailto:[EMAIL PROTECTED] On Behalf Of Jeff Beeman
> Sent: Tuesday, August 02, 2005 9:17 AM
> To: flexcoders@yahoogroups.com
> Subject: [flexcoders] Passing variables into an alert handler
> 
> I'm trying to pass variables into the Delegate that I have 
> run during an
> alert.  Here is the code I currently have:
> 
> alert("Delete record?", "Alert", mx.controls.Alert.OK |
> mx.controls.Alert.CANCEL, Delegate.create(this, this.alertHandler),
> mx.controls.Alert.CANCEL);
> 
> I would like to be able to pass variables into the alertHandler, i.e.:
> 
> Alert(... ..., Delegate.create(this, this.alertHandler({ 
> myVar:'apples',
> myFoo:'Bar' });
> 
> This works... but the problem is that the 'event' is no longer passed.
> Trying to add 'myEvent:event' to that object doesn't work, as I get an
> error returned saying 'event' doesn't exist.
> 
> Is there a way to pass variables using the method above while still
> capturing the event details?
> 
> 
> 
> 
> /***
> * Jeff Beeman
> * Digital Media & Instructional Technologies
> * Arizona State University
> ***/
> 
> 
> 
> 
> 
>  Yahoo! Groups Sponsor 
> ~--> 
>  href="http://us.ard.yahoo.com/SIG=12hn4jb9f/M=362131.6882499.7
> 825260.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123006875
> /A=2889191/R=0/SIG=10r90krvo/*http://www.thebeehive.org
> ">Get Bzzzy! (real tools to help you find a job) Welcome to 
> the Sweet Life - brought to you by One Economy.
> --
> --~-> 
> 
> --
> Flexcoders Mailing List
> F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
> Search Archives: 
> http://www.mail-archive.com/flexcoders%40yahoogroups.com 
> Yahoo! Groups Links
> 
> 
> 
>  
> 
> 
> 


 Yahoo! Groups Sponsor ~--> 
http://us.ard.yahoo.com/SIG=12htq29fs/M=362329.6886308.7839368.1510227/D=groups/S=1705007207:TM/Y=YAHOO/EXP=1123024998/A=2894321/R=0/SIG=11dvsfulr/*http://youthnoise.com/page.php?page_id=1992
">Fair play? Video games influencing politics. Click and talk back!.
~-> 

--
Flexcoders Mailing List
F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com 
Yahoo! Groups Links

<*> To visit your group on the web, go to:
http://groups.yahoo.com/group/flexcoders/

<*> To unsubscribe from this group, send an email to:
[EMAIL PROTECTED]

<*> Your use of Yahoo! Groups is subject to:
http://docs.yahoo.com/info/terms/